Church Roof Replacement Services

Roof replacement for churches involves removing the existing roofing material and installing a new, durable roof system to protect the building’s structure and interior. This process typically includes inspecting the underlying roof deck, repairing any damaged areas, and applying new roofing materials suitable for the building’s design and purpose. The service may also involve upgrading insulation, ventilation, and drainage systems to ensure optimal performance and longevity of the new roof. Professionals specializing in church roof replacement can assess the specific needs of each property and recommend appropriate solutions to enhance durability and aesthetic appeal.

This service addresses several common problems faced by church owners and facility managers. Over time, roofs can develop leaks, become damaged by severe weather, or suffer from age-related deterioration that compromises their integrity. Water infiltration can lead to interior damage, mold growth, and increased maintenance costs. Replacing an aging or damaged roof helps prevent these issues, ensuring the building remains safe and functional for congregations and visitors. Additionally, a new roof can improve energy efficiency and reduce long-term repair expenses, making it a valuable investment for maintaining the property’s value and appearance.

The overview below groups typical Church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Northfield,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material and Size Costs - The cost of replacing a church roof varies based on the materials used and the size of the building. Typical expenses range from $10,000 to $50,000 for standard-sized structures. Larger or more complex roofs can cost significantly more, depending on specifications.

Labor and Removal Expenses - Labor costs for church roof replacement generally account for 40-60% of the total project budget. Removal of existing roofing may add $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the extent of existing materials and accessibility.

Permitting and Inspection Fees - Local permits and inspections are required for roof replacement projects and can range from $500 to $2,000. These costs vary based on local regulations and the project's scope.

Additional Services and Upgrades - Optional upgrades such as enhanced insulation or specialized roofing materials can increase overall costs by several thousand dollars.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How long does a church roof replacement typically take? The duration of a church roof replacement depends on the size and complexity of the roof, but local contractors can provide estimates based on the specific project.

What types of roofing materials are suitable for church buildings?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and slate, with local service providers able to advise on the best choice for a church’s structure and style.

Is a permit required for replacing a church roof? Permit requirements vary by location; contacting local authorities or contractors can clarify the necessary approvals for roof replacement projects.

What signs indicate that a church roof needs replacement? Signs include visible damage, leaks, missing shingles, or significant wear, which can be assessed by local roofing professionals.
